Maleat
Maleat is primarily a painter who draws on inspiration from artists Pablo Picasso, Paul Klee and the Cubist movement. She creates striking artwork often referencing a piece of art and interpreting it in her own style. Recently, Maleat has started to explore her Eritrean heritage in her artwork as she is very proud of her culture.
Maleat said creating art and coming to the studio to work with volunteers makes her happy. She aspires to have her paintings on exhibition and become an Artbox Volunteer in the future.
Outside of Artbox, Maleat attends College and will be soon starting an internship. She hopes to find an internship related to her passion for cooking and baking. She says she gets joy out of creating for her family whether that is through cooking or art.
